To be truly responsive to learner needs at every stage of the Career Technical Education (CTE) continuum, CTE programs must be designed with learners through their direct and ongoing input into program design and delivery.

Advance CTE releases various resources to encourage states to engage learners’ feedback and input more meaningfully in designing, implementing, delivering, and improving CTE programs and policies.
